WebSep 26, 2024 · Common causes include arthritis, ligament and meniscus tears, tendonitis, and patellofemoral pain syndrome. Dislocations, fractures, and bone tumors are less common. Knee pain is diagnosed based on a description of symptoms and triggers, physical exam, and possibly imaging studies. Treatment depends on the cause. WebApr 8, 2016 · Key clinical point: Several signs and symptoms could be used to help identify patients with osteoarthritis (OA) up to 5 years before joint damage occurs. Major finding: Knee pain on most days of the last month was predictive of both MRI and radiographic knee damage. Data source: 592 women from the Rotterdam Study without knee OA at baseline.

This problem is most often seen in athletes who do repetitive jumping—the reason patellar tendonitis is often called "jumper's knee." Patellar tendonitis is most often seen in participants of sports such as basketball and volleyball, although it can also be ...
